The above link is a resource for those who need help calculating their GPA. Plug in the following classes and your grades.
EN 101 English Composition I 3 credits
PSYC-101 Psychology I 3 credits
MATH-119/MATH-336 Math I 3 credits
BI-301 Anatomy and Physiology I 4 credits
Total Pre-Clinical Credits - 13
As per their website the following substitutions are allowed for an overall stronger GPA.
Bio-302 for Bio-301
Eng-102 for Eng-101
PSYC-220 for PSYC-101
And I was told by the nursing department to substitute my A&P I score (B-) for my A&P II score (A).

Studying for the pax I used the Red NLN RN Pre-Entrance EXAM book that was suggested, the practice exams provided by NLN website, the NLN PAX app on iphone and quizlets (although quizlets were just a lot of regurgitated from the NLN website)
For some background information, I applied previously to an accelerated private school program and got in, however that school was not yet accredited and I did not want to gamble with loans. I took the HESI for that school and got an almost perfect score (subtle brag) but I definitely felt that compared to the content on the PAX, the HESI exam was easier and it did not have a physics topic.
